The municipal workshop for the conservation of historical heritage begins the repair of the stature of the Blessed Virgin of Mercy, of Paso Morado (28/11/2018)

It is an image that is part of the procession of this Brotherhood, and that presented multiple deteriorations, many of them derived from the earthquakes of the year 2011 and the precipitations in the course of its procession.

The restoration is directed by the author's son of carving.

The Local Development Councilor in the City of Lorca, Sandra Martinez, reported that the Workshop of Conservation of Historical Heritage of this municipal area will begin the restoration of the size of the Blessed Virgin of Mercy, owned by the Brotherhood of the Most Holy Christ of the Forgiveness of Lorca, Paso Morado.

We are talking about a piece that is kept in the parish church of Ntra. Señora del Carmen and that was carved by the Murcian sculptor Antonio García Mengual in 1982 (Salzillo Prize).

It is a sculptural group of round shape and natural size, carved in coniferous wood on volume built with pieces assembled in ambo and polychromed with oils.

Regarding its iconography, the image represents the Virgin Mary sitting holding on his right knee the body of Jesus Christ after the descent of the Cross.

In relation to the previous actions, we must indicate that repaints and varnish subsequent to its original state are appreciated.

Martínez Navarro explained that the analysis carried out to date on its state of conservation states that currently the work is in a state of deficit conservation, with the following pathologies:

Large cracks are seen both at the base and in the bodies of the images, due to the movements of the structural pieces of wood, inadequate handling and abrupt changes in temperature and humidity.

At this point it is necessary to point out the forced and hurried transfer that had to be made with the sculpture after the 2011 earthquakes.

Repaints are appreciated and varnished after the original, very oxidized.

Chromatic alteration due to surface dirt.

Scratches and loss of color in the most exposed areas, such as hands and feet.

Crown of thorns very deteriorated.

Disappearance of a crystal tear.

Application of synthetic putty in holes of the base.

Incorporation for your shipments of metallic support badly crimped and dimensioned.

The Local Development Council has stated that the object of action proposed by the technicians considers the proposed intervention aims to ensure the integral conservation of the sculpture, through the established criteria of conservation and restoration.

Preserving at all times the original elements and intervening only in those aspects that produce deterioration and degradation of the whole.

In order to ensure its future conservation and recover its dignity and understanding.

With these premises, the following treatments are considered pertinent:

Sealing of fissures by injections of polyvinyl acetate.

Elimination of synthetic putties.

Reintegration of the original gear losses in lagoons and fissures, with traditional tails of organic tails similar to the original ones.

Physical-chemical cleaning to remove the layer of superficial dirt, the oxidized varnish and the punctual repaint, after a solubility test.

Differentiated chromatic reintegration.

Restoration of the crown of thorns.

Replacement of glass teardrop.

Final varnish of protection with varnish stable to oxidation and ultraviolet rays, in order to improve its conservation.

Execution of a new metallic support suitable for transport.

Sandra Martinez has indicated that this workshop is composed of a monitor and 8 students.

On behalf of the council has also decided to provide the Paso Morado with adequate support to facilitate the transport and / or displacement of this size on, a structure that will be made by the components of the locksmith workshop of the City Council .

This will prevent possible damage to the image of the Virgin in the future.
